Eucommia ulmoides Oliv is a kind of special Chinese herbal medicine and important industrial raw materials of plant, it was found that a large number of medicinal ingredients contained in eucommia bark and the leaf which can cure many diseases. Therefore it is very active in the field of natural medicine research and has very broad comprehensive utilization.With the development of enzyme preparation, more and more researchers are agreed with the method of extracting natural ingredients in Eucommiae bark by enzyme engineering. The pathogenicity of plants found that its cutinase can damage the cuticle of the host plants. So our research group have targeted screening a kind of strain which could effective degrade the cuticle of Eucommia ulmoides leaves, the strain identified as Rhodotorula mucilaginosa.After researching on the growth characteristics of Rhodotorula mucilaginosa, it was induced ferment produce cutinase. According to the literature reports, the commonly used inducer is plants’ cutin, the manufactur of cutin was very complex, and the large-scale application of cutinase was restricted.Therefore,the work looking for new inducer that can replace the cutin is imperative.After many tests we found the effect of using linseed oil to do the inducer is good, and the linseed oil is cheap and easy to get, this new discovery can reduce the production cost and work greatly, improve the production efficiency. In order to apply the method to the production practice, this paper has done the following work:1. Compared the induction effect of olive oil, rapeseed oil, linseed oil and cutin, screening suitable inducers to produced cutinase efficient. The contrast found, cutinase activity is higher than other inducers when we choose linseed oil for inducer, it is 1.5 times as without inducer. And we make a detail study on the fermentation conditions of induction to confirm the process parameters.2. The study on enzymatic properties of Rhodotorula mucilaginosa cutinase. Mainly includes the optimum reaction temperature, thermal stability, optimum pH, pH stability, as well as the influence of some metal ions on cutinase activity.3. The enzyme combined extraction. Combined extraction of natural components in Eucommia ulmoides leaves with cutinase, protease, pectinase and cellulase. After removed the cuticle, pectin, cellulose, the enzymatic liquid collection step by step. Then filtering, concentrating, alcohol extraction, and finally load to β-cyclodextrin,made Eucommia ulmoides powder. HPLC was used in analysis and determination of the content of chlorogenic acid in Eucommia ulmoides powder, and confirmed the detection method.
